Increased rent and continuous break-ins were cited as the reasons for the closure. Tiger Tea said the two factors made it “unsustainable” for the business to run. “Despite our best efforts, we no longer see a viable path forward for this store,” said Tiger Tea.
Tiger Tea & Juice thanked its patrons for their “loyalty, encouragement, and kindness.”
“This shop holds countless memories—of first-time visitors who became regulars, of laughter shared over drinks, and of the friendships that blossomed within these walls,” the tea shop said on its social media.
Established in the San Francisco Bay Area, the tea shop has been operating for a decade. Per Tiger Tea & Juice’s, its beverages are sourced from “the finest teas” worldwide without any artificial colors or flavors.
The tea shop confirms that patrons who have unused store credit or gift cards should contact the company, and they can transfer or refund the credits.
Tiger Tea & Juice currently has locations in Daly City, Burlingame, and San Mateo.
